Summary
Uncaught Exception in mercurius
Details

Impact

Any users from Mercurius@8.10.0 to 8.11.1 are subjected to a denial of service attack by sending a malformed JSON to /graphql unless they are using a custom error handler.

Patches

The vulnerability has been fixed in https://github.com/mercurius-js/mercurius/pull/678 and shipped as v8.11.2.

Workarounds

Use a custom error handler.

References

See https://github.com/mercurius-js/mercurius/issues/677
